Pure β-carotene was encapsulated in 25 Dextrose Equivalent maltodextrin by three drying processes (spray, freeze and drum). Stability was studied at 11% and 32% RH and 25°C, 35°C and 45°C. No significant influence of %RH was observed on the retention of β-carotene. Oxidation followed first order kinetics with an initial fast first …

Spray drying of food: principles and applications
A modern spray dryer consists of three main parts, an atomizer, a drying chamber, and the powder collection unit. During a spray drying process, a prepared solution, suspension, or emulsion, i.e., feedstock, is pumped through the atomizer at a specific feed rate. The feedstock is then atomized into droplets in the range of several to …

Roller Dryers
Both single- and double-drum dryers have high drying rates, high energy efficiencies and low labour requirements. They are suitable for slurries in which the particles are too large for spray drying, including a wide range of products that are converted to flakes or powders, which can be quickly rehydrated (e.g. potato flakes, precooked breakfast cereals, …

Drum Drying
Drum drying is energy efficient for the drying of pulpy and highly viscous foods. However, with the development of spray drying, the use drum drying to produce milk powder has been reduced. However, drum dryers are preferred when the requirement is for powdered foods with a flaky structure and enhanced rehydration characteristics.

What is Drum Dryer? Working Principle, Construction, …
Construction of Drum Dryer. It consists of a cylindrical, hollow drum made up of metal. The drum is mounted horizontally on a stand and rotates on its longitudinal axis. A pipe is fitted at the center of the drum for passing steam. The drum has a smooth surface with a length of about 60 to 40 cm and a diameter of about 60 to 300 cm.

Advantages and challenges of the spray-drying technology …
Spray-drying is a technique based on the transformation of a fluid into a dry powder by atomization in a hot drying gas stream that is generally air [1].The spray-drying process consists of four fundamental steps: (i) atomization of the liquid feed, (ii) drying of spray into drying gas, (iii) formation of dry particles and (iv) separation and collection of …
